I don't love props but if done well, I can see where it can boost visual effect. If you have 130 MM on the field (excluding pit) and add 50 trees (or mirrors, chairs etc), you now have 180 elements which can move or be staged to transform a field into whatever mood you're attempting to create.

BD has been much better than let's say, Cadets, in utilizing props effectively. So when BD announces props will be utilized, I'm ok. On the other hand, when Cadets say it, I'm crossing my fingers. No other corps comes to mind as far as consistently being effective with props..
